- What is Adient's other americas — consolidated net sales?
- Adient (ADNT) reported other americas — consolidated net sales of $79M in Q1 2026.
- How has Adient's other americas — consolidated net sales changed year-over-year?
- Adient's other americas — consolidated net sales increased by 12.9% year-over-year, from $70M to $79M.
- What is the long-term trend for Adient's other americas — consolidated net sales?
- Over 4 years (2021 to 2025), Adient's other americas — consolidated net sales has grown at a -1.1%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$312M to $299M.
- What does other americas — consolidated net sales mean?
- This metric represents the total revenue generated from external customers within the company's 'Other Americas' geographic segment, excluding the primary domestic market. It serves as a key indicator of the company's market penetration and demand for automotive seating solutions in secondary regional territories. Tracking this figure helps investors assess the geographic diversification of the company's sales base and the performance of regional operations outside of core markets.
